I 446 T has come to my knowledge that It Is being currently reported that I had at some time written to the Government, askthem to REDUCE THE WAGES of their WOBKING MEN. This I most positively DENY. I never wrote to the Government, nor did any person on my behalf, about men or their wages. JOHN ANDERSON. Lichfield street, December sth, 1881. TEMPERANCE ELECTORS.
